wip: github actions

This commit is contained in:
Frank 2025-07-16 16:05:51 +08:00
parent cb032cff2b
commit 7ac0a2bc65
4 changed files with 18 additions and 11 deletions

View file

@ -17,7 +17,7 @@ jobs:
fetch-depth: 1
- name: Run opencode
uses: sst/opencode/sdks/github@dev
uses: sst/opencode/sdks/github@github-v1
env:
ANTHROPIC_API_KEY: ${{ secrets.ANTHROPIC_API_KEY }}
with:

View file

@ -26,5 +26,4 @@ jobs:
run: |
git config --global user.email "opencode@sst.dev"
git config --global user.name "opencode"
./script/publish-github-action.ts
working-directory: ./packages/opencode
./scripts/publish-github-action.ts

View file

@ -1,8 +0,0 @@
#!/usr/bin/env bun
import { $ } from "bun"
await $`git tag -d github-v1`
await $`git push origin :refs/tags/github-v1`
await $`git tag -a github-v1 -m "Update github-v1 to latest"`
await $`git push origin github-v1`

View file

@ -0,0 +1,16 @@
#!/usr/bin/env bun
import { $ } from "bun"
try {
await $`git tag -d github-v1`
await $`git push origin :refs/tags/github-v1`
} catch (e) {
if (e instanceof Error && e.message.includes("not found")) {
console.log("tag not found, continuing...")
} else {
throw e
}
}
await $`git tag -a github-v1 -m "Update github-v1 to latest"`
await $`git push origin github-v1`